FGSAX vs. SPY
Compare and contrast key facts about Federated Hermes MDT Mid Cap Growth Fund (FGSAX) and State Street SPDR S&P 500 ETF (SPY).
FGSAX is managed by Federated. It was launched on Aug 23, 1984. SPY is a passively managed fund by State Street that tracks the performance of the S&P 500 Index. It was launched on Jan 22, 1993.

Correlation
The correlation between FGSAX and SPY is 0.84,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.
